About This Project
As part of our Women’s Empowerment Program, Mama Molo’s goal was to create a true social business that elevated women through education, skills creation and employment opportunities to improve their lives and those of their families.
Hand Made by MAMA MOLO
An additional layer to the Mama Molo project was Hand made by Mama Molo, a social impact brand that was established to showcase and build a marketplace for artisan products, handmade by more than 50 women working together in weaving groups in rural Kenya.
Following our Sustainability Plan, the Hand Made by MAMA MOLO team is now empowered with both the sewing skills and the business — this means they are able to continue to generate their own income, while also providing and creating new opportunities for their community.

About This Project
Chazon Africa Family Empowerment program exists to empower families to care for and educate their children in the long term, by simultaneously tackling social and economic barriers to education. Our work with families to build their source of income for their children’s care, combines practical business training and mentoring, access to saving schemes and in some cases, cash grants.
Mavuno Empowerment project
Mavuno Empowerment Project runs training days four times a year, impacting over 400 local farmers, students and parents from the surrounding communities.
To continue to support the wider community through education on improved farming practices which will result in improved food security and economic stability for the communities in Molo.
Mavuno is a demonstration farm that focuses on cultivating crops to train the local farmers, parents and students in improved agricultural practices. This training aims to improve the capacity and economic stability of the community.
Our main customers of farm produce are the surrounding local markets and beyond. We are proud of our long term relationships with these reliable customers.
Mavuno also runs poultry farm, Beehives andDairy farming.
